Output 81c1438d75d11118cb8a7ff01bf88a6b9c29f514f6a016df932de26289587482:0

value
88640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 653d70a6521136ba504f52775c482b764158caca OP_EQUAL
address
3AvKmr6ZA4sU5BDZTWJF2qPiHqhB4dqL9G
transaction
81c1438d75d11118cb8a7ff01bf88a6b9c29f514f6a016df932de26289587482
spent
true